Global Compressed Natural Gas (CNG) and Liquefied
Petroleum Gas (LPG) Vehicles Market is projected to reach USD 42.3 billion by 2032,
growing at a CAGR of 6.4% from 2025, according to latest industry
analysis. Currently valued at USD 25.8 billion, this market is being driven by
tightening emission regulations and the global transition toward cleaner fuel
alternatives. While commercial fleets remain the primary adopters, passenger
vehicle conversions are gaining momentum in price-sensitive markets where fuel
costs significantly impact total ownership expenses.

Market Overview & Regional Analysis
Asia-Pacific commands
the largest market share at 45%, led by India's ambitious city gas distribution
projects and China's focus on cleaner public transportation. The region hosts
over 5 million CNG vehicles, with India alone adding nearly 1,000 new fueling
stations annually to support its growing NGV fleet. Meanwhile, Europe shows
diverging trends - while Western markets gradually shift toward EVs, Eastern
European countries like Poland continue expanding LPG infrastructure due to its
cost advantages over conventional fuels.
North America
demonstrates steady growth, particularly in refuse collection and transit bus
segments where fleets benefit from stable CNG pricing. The U.S. market features
over 1,500 public CNG stations, with California and Texas leading in adoption.
Latin America remains the global stronghold for LPG vehicles, where Brazil's
flexible-fuel vehicle technology has been adapted for widespread gasoline/LPG
switching.
Key Market Drivers and Opportunities
Environmental regulations
are proving to be the most significant growth catalyst, with Euro 7 standards
and India's BS-VI norms pushing automakers to develop cleaner combustion
technologies. Fleet operators are increasingly adopting CNG/LPG solutions not
just for compliance, but also because of the 30-50% fuel cost savings compared
to diesel. Emerging opportunities include:
- Development of renewable natural gas (RNG) supply
chains that can make CNG vehicles carbon-neutral
- Expansion of last-mile delivery networks using LPG-powered
three-wheelers in urban areas
- Integration of hydrogen blends in existing CNG
infrastructure for future-proofing investments
Vehicle manufacturers
are responding with innovative solutions like Volkswagen's TGI series and
Ford's dedicated CNG pickup trucks, which offer comparable performance to
traditional models. The commercial vehicle segment particularly benefits from
dual-fuel technologies that provide flexibility during infrastructure
transitions.
Challenges & Restraints
Despite the
advantages, several barriers continue limiting widespread adoption:
Infrastructure Gaps: Developing nations still face critical
shortages in refueling stations, with CNG coverage below 10% of conventional
fuel outlets in most emerging markets. This creates operational challenges for
long-haul transportation and deters private vehicle conversions.
Competition from EVs: Growing government support for electric
vehicles is redirecting both policy support and consumer interest away from
gas-powered alternatives. Several automakers have deprioritized CNG/LPG
development in favor of electrification roadmaps.
Technology
Limitations: While modern CNG
systems have improved, vehicles still experience 8-12% power reduction and
require larger fuel tanks that compromise cargo space. These tradeoffs remain
problematic for performance-focused buyers.
